The Associate of Arts (A.A.) college transfer program prepares students to transfer to a four-year college or university to earn a baccalaureate degree in such areas as education, English, prelaw, history, business administration, psychology or social work. With the help of an academic advisor, the student will plan a program of study to meet the requirements of the college to which the student wishes to transfer based on the program guidelines below.
There are additional A.A. transfer options. Students should discuss which is right for their eventual goals with both their TCL academic advisor as well as with the four-year institution to which they plan to transfer. |
